基于Servlet+JSP的学生成绩管理系统
项目简介
本项目是一个基于Servlet和JSP的学生成绩管理系统。该系统功能简单,适合用于学习、课程设计或大作业等场景。系统采用JSP页面和Form表单提交数据,实现了学生成绩的增删改查等基本功能。项目采用MVC设计模式,通过JDBC连接数据库进行开发。
功能特点
- 学生成绩的增删改查功能
- 采用MVC设计模式
- 使用JDBC连接数据库
开发环境与运行环境
- 推荐JDK版本: JDK 1.8
- 开发工具: Eclipse 或 IntelliJ IDEA(推荐)
- 操作系统: Windows 10(推荐,8G内存以上),其他Windows版本及macOS支持,但不推荐
- 浏览器: Firefox(推荐)、Google Chrome(推荐)、Edge
- 数据库: MySQL 8.0(推荐),其他版本支持,但容易出现异常,尤其是MySQL 5.7及以下版本
- 数据库可视化工具: Navicat Premium 15(推荐),其他Navicat版本支持
项目技术栈
- 后端: MySQL、JDBC、Servlet
- 前端: JSP
是否Maven项目
否
注意事项
- 本项目不支持Maven管理。
- 推荐使用MySQL 8.0版本,其他版本可能会出现异常。
- 推荐使用Firefox或Google Chrome浏览器进行测试。
- 推荐使用Navicat Premium 15进行数据库管理。
适用场景
- 学习Servlet和JSP技术
- 课程设计或大作业
- 简单的学生成绩管理系统需求